We are seeking an experienced Senior Risk and Compliance Lawyer to join our international law firm. The successful candidate will be responsible for managing our global professional indemnity insurance programme and handling professional indemnity claims against the firm.
Additionally they will provide expert advice and guidance on regulatory and compliance matters and assist with risk-related training initiatives.
Responsibilities
Professional Indemnity Management
- Oversee the firms global professional indemnity insurance programme ensuring coverage meets the firms needs and is compliant with international legal standards.
- Handle all aspects of professional indemnity claims made against the firm working closely with internal teams and external counsel to manage and resolve claims efficiently.
- Liaise with insurers and brokers to negotiate policy terms and manage claims notifications.
Regulatory and Compliance Guidance
- Provide specialist advice on regulatory compliance issues ensuring the firm adheres to legal and ethical standards across all jurisdictions.
- Monitor changes in relevant legislation and update firm policies and procedures accordingly.
- Collaborate with different departments to implement compliance programmes and initiatives.
Risk Management
- Identify potential risk areas within the firm and develop strategies to mitigate these risks.
- Conduct risk assessments and audits to ensure adherence to compliance policies.
- Prepare detailed reports for senior management on risk exposure advising on appropriate courses of action.
Training and Development
- Develop and deliver risk and compliance training sessions to increase awareness and understanding across the firm.
- Create informative materials to enhance the firms compliance culture and promote best practices.
- Stay informed about industry trends and innovations in risk management and compliance sharing insights with the team.
Experience and Knowledge
- Qualified lawyer with extensive experience in risk management and compliance preferably within a large international law firm.
- Proven track record in managing professional indemnity insurance and claims.
- Strong knowledge of international regulatory frameworks and compliance requirements.
- Excellent analytical problem-solving and decision-making skills.
- Outstanding communication and interpersonal skills with the ability to influence and engage stakeholders at all levels.
- High ethical standards and integrity.
- Strong attention to detail and organisational skills.
- Ability to work independently and handle multiple tasks simultaneously.
- Proactive and adaptable with a drive to continuously improve processes.
